Biography

Lawrence Zbikowski’s principal research interests involve applying recent work in cognitive science, particularly cognitive linguistics and cognitive psychology, to problems confronted by music scholars. His recent book, Foundations of Musical Grammar (Oxford University Press, 2017), builds on research regarding the fundamental aspects of human communication to explore the basis of constructing meaningful musical utterances. His recent seminars have focused on meter and rhythm, theories of embodiment in relation to musical knowledge, and the application of recent work on affect in music, examining how ideas of agency are manifested in musical practice. He teaches analysis courses that deal with a wide range of music, and has lately focused on music from the 18th and 19th centuries.
